In the last 18 months iPhone has captured 20 percent of the portable gaming market and five percent of the global videogame market, which is worth approximately 50 billion dollars a year to Apple.
The mobile game market is booming and Apple has over 100 million game platforms out there in the form of iPhones and iPods. ”Apple’s App Store currently has over 300,000 applications that includes many free to try games and includes full versions of the games with prices in the single dollar range”, says Ken Burridge (founder of GameMaster.com). The other big trend besides iPhone game popularity says Mr Burridge are “the social network games such as those found of facebook and mobile games in general have easily become the fastest-growing segments of the game industry.”.
That also explains the move by such video game giants as Electronic Arts purchase of Playfish for approximately 300 million USD last year. Playfish is a creator of social games for: Facebook, MySpace, Bebo, Google, iPhone and Android. Each of the company’s seven games has been a top 10 hit on facebook and other social networks.
